transfer problem

i have 97 f150 with a 5.4 4X4. when i put it in 4h or 4L my front end is not powered. i hear the tansfer shirft when i turn the **** but only my back tires are the only ones what had power going to them. i found this out when i got stuck in sand. any ideas??

Start by Jacking up the front so the wheels are off the ground. With the truck in park and the engine running engage 4hi. Get under the truck and try turning the front drive shaft. It should not turn. If it does your t-case is not engaged in 4Hi.
The most likely cause is the shift motor. If the front driveshaft doesn't turn the T-case is fine. You will need to check the front axle engagement for problems.
